Nocode, or Visual Programming, is an approach to Software Development that allows programmers to create application software through graphical interfaces and configuration instead of "traditional" text-based computer programming.I also have 10 years of experience as IT Professional and working within a variety of high energy businesses. Software DeveloperJuiced Fuel Nov 2021 - Nov 2024Charleston, Sc, UsI designed and developed a "car fuel delivery" web-based application using a leading no-code tool, Bubble. The app allows car owners living in Charleston, South Carolina, to request on-demand car fuel to be delivered to their vehicle.I acquired this project via Round Pegs who had acquired it via Launchpeer and so I had to work with the PMs from both to manage the project. The objective was to build a prototype as a proof of concept, but later evolved into developing an MVP.Customers would create a fuel request by adding their car's location, details, and selecting a fuel type. JuicedFuel employees would manage these requests by assigning them to "Drivers" who would deliver the fuel. Once the driver delivers, they'll send an invoice to the customer who would receive a text notification to pay it.I integrated a few technologies such as Stripe for payments, Twilio for texts notifications, and Google Maps for geocoding and location tracking.The project has concluded, and the client is preparing to launch. Software DeveloperVideorevv May 2021 - Apr 2022I designed and developed a "Video As A Service" web-based application using a leading no-code tool, Bubble. The app allows brands to create scroll-stopping video ads by describing the look, feel, and theme for an ad and submitting their media assets which are then taken by an editor and brought to life.I acquired this project via Round Pegs and worked with the PMs and client to manage it. Initially, the goal was to take the client's existing website and rebuild it as it within a no-code platform, Bubble. As the project went on, the client became more impressed with my work and became inspired to build an entirely new version of the app with new features and new functionality.From that point, the client and I worked together. They worked on designs in Figma and I brought them to life in Bubble. We kept track of tasks via Asana. I also integrated Stripe for payments and built custom API calls for the app to work with Frame.io, an online video collaboration tool, which the editors would use.The project has concluded, and the client is preparing to launch.
